Increased Blood Circulation Walking on a treadmill beneath your desk can help improve blood circulation, increase the amount of energy you have, boost your physical health and decrease back pain. Walking is a low impact exercise that allows people to move without putting excessive stress on their bodies. It also increases oxygen levels in blood, which could increase focus and concentration when working. This is why a lot of people are opting to utilize treadmill desks in their work environments to exercise while they work. According to a study, regular walking in the office can improve performance and reduce the risk of health problems associated with long sitting. The study used meta-analysis and data from several studies to calculate effect sizes. To identify relevant studies, researchers searched CINAHL, EMBASE, MEDLINE, Web of Science, and Scopus for English-language research that was published through December 2020. Random effects meta-analysis models were then used to aggregate the results of individual studies. The study revealed that treadmill desk users answered the questions with a true or false answer 35% more accurately than those who didn't use treadmill desks. The study's authors believe this is due to the fact that treadmill desks can improve productivity and focus. The study found that treadmill desks may lower the risk of developing chronic diseases such as diabetes and heart disease. There are many kinds of treadmills under desk available There are however a few important features to consider when you purchase one. Included in this list are the speed and incline options along with noise levels and storage options. Speed and incline settings let you to tailor your workout according to your fitness level and intensity preferences. You can, for instance increase your speed to jog after a leisurely walk. The incline setting mimics walking uphill and engages different muscles. The best under-desk machines are programmable and allows you set and monitor your daily goals. You can also track your progress with a mobile app. This can be a great incentive tool to motivate users to walk more often throughout the day and achieve their goals. 2. Studies have shown that sitting for long periods of time can increase the risk of developing heart disease and cancer, obesity and early death. Installing a small treadmill under your desk to your office is an excellent way to remain active at work and reverse some negative effects of sitting for too long. In addition to the numerous other benefits of walking on a treadmill during work, it can also reduce your risk of heart disease by keeping your blood pressure in an acceptable range. Regular walking has been shown to lower cholesterol levels blood sugar, triglycerides, and blood sugar. It can also help reduce body fat. A treadmill at your desk can help improve posture, which can help reduce neck and back pain. It is essential to make sure that the treadmill is set up at a height that is comfortable for you, so that it isn't difficult to walk at an easy speed. It is also a good idea to wear shoes that are suitable for walking, like running or walking shoes. It is also a good idea to gradually increase the time spent on the treadmill under your desk. Begin with 15 minutes a day and gradually work your way to a minimum of an hour per day. Studies have found that people who exercise while working benefit from a myriad of positive health benefits, including lower blood pressure, improved metabolic and cardiovascular health as well as improved productivity and mental health. While some studies didn't find significant physiological changes, the direction in which the effect is favored by treadmill desk users was observed to be positive for all outcomes examined. These included blood pressure, fasting sugar, high density lipoproteins, triglycerides and total cholesterol. 4. One concern is that the treadmill could create an excessive amount of noise which can be disruptive in the office environment that is shared. However, there are several methods to minimize this issue, for instance selecting a treadmill with noise-canceling features or putting the treadmill in a separate area that employees cannot hear it. If you are considering purchasing a treadmill under your desk ensure you select one with a large user weight capacity and a wide belt. The Lifespan TR1200-DT3 under desk treadmill, for example it has a capacity of 350 pounds and a vast surface area that can support your entire body weight without compromising stability. It is also recommended to choose a quiet treadmill, so you can focus on your work.
